What is the PPAI North American Leadership Conference?
The two-and-a-half day conference delves into the business issues, trends and best practices that have the biggest impact on the promotional product industry. The event, primarily focused on networking, allows our industry’s top business leaders to exchange ideas and plan for the future. In addition to keynote presentations from Alibaba.com general manager Annie Xu and best-selling author Don Deppers, the event also features several informative breakout sessions, product safety presentations, as well as a charity golf tournament.
Examining the Future of the Industry
Yesterday, Jim moderated one of the aforementioned breakout sessions, a panel discussion on what technological trends will have the greatest impact on the promotional product industry over the next five years. While we will have to wait for Jim to return to the office on Thursday to learn the exact outcome of the discussion, I found in my preliminary research for the presentation that the promotional product industry (and commerce in general) will move increasingly from offline phone calls, catalog orders, and in-person purchase agreements to online ordering systems as well as mobile commerce driven by QR codes and smartphones.
